How do transistors store data?

In a semiconductor memory chip, each bit of binary data is stored in a tiny circuit called a memory cell consisting of one to several transistors. Data is accessed by means of a binary number called a memory address applied to the chip’s address pins, which specifies which word in the chip is to be accessed.

How does a memory chip store data?

While logic chips work as the “brains” of an electronic device, performing functions using mathematical operations, memory chips store data. The basic building block of a memory chip is a cell, a tiny circuit with a capacitor (which stores data as a charge) and one or more transistors (which activate data).

What is the memory of ROM?

Read-only memory (ROM) is a type of non-volatile memory used in computers and other electronic devices. Data stored in ROM cannot be electronically modified after the manufacture of the memory device.

What is ROM and its advantages?

Advantages of ROM Its static nature means it does not require refreshing. ROM is more reliable than RAM since it is non-volatile in nature and cannot be altered or accidentally changed. The contents of the ROM can always be known and verified. Less expensive than RAM.

Is hard disk a ROM?

A hard disk or any mass storage is not a ROM (Read-Only Memory). A hard disk is data that is stored in a structure (sectors) that needs to be read by software by groups. A ROM (or RAM – Random Access Memory) is memory that is directly accessed by individual words or bytes directly by the CPU.
